We built this beauty at Hendrick’s request.The classic Iceman design served as the basis, of course.The original Ibanez model, built in the late 70s for Paul Stanley of Kiss, even had a real, broken glass mirror (!) on the top.To replicate this look, we opted for mirrored acrylic glass.All the pieces were individually cut, sanded, polished, pieced together like a puzzle, and finally glued on.That alone took about three full days.But the result is a spectacular eye-catcher, I’d say!Instead of the original’s silver, Hendrick chose a gold mirror and gold hardware for an extra “bling” factor. 🙂 Beyond its looks, it’s also a perfectly stage-ready guitar with top-notch sound and first-class hardware!This is ensured by the two Harry Häussel pickups (one P90 at the neck and a fat humbucker at the bridge), as well as the ABM 5200 tremolo combined with Schaller locking tuners.
All in all, a real eye- and ear-catcher on any stage.Understatement is overrated anyway 😉
